Look, there’s a nuance here - this is not a website or a set of forms, but a product platform with payments, roles, a map, subscriptions, documents, and future integrations. !!5000 EUR will not be enough for a full MVP of this level!! - for this budget, you can create the architecture, prototype key screens, decompose, and plan the launch. In terms of timelines, I would estimate 100-130 working days and a preliminary budget starting from 55,000 EUR for the first production version. Support after launch - the guideline is 1500-4000 EUR per month, depending on the load, level of support, and number of external integrations =/

For the architecture, I would propose Next.js, NestJS, PostgreSQL, a modular server part, REST API for future mobile applications, a payment layer separate from orders and parking, and CRM not as a side application, but as the operational center of the platform. I would start with parking, vehicle profile, payments, transaction history, and admin panel, while insurance and integrations with state registries would be moved to the second stage - this reduces risk at the start and makes it easier to check the economics.

For post-launch support, we usually separate technical support, product enhancements, and monitoring of integrations. Among the improvements, I would add a role model for partners, a log of all financial events, a clear pricing matrix for parking, and a separate layer for future license plate recognition.

Hello! Senior Fullstack, 14+ years of experience. Ready to start now — I am not working on other projects, dedicating a minimum of 8 hours a day to the project. Relevant experience: u-erp (ERP/CRM from scratch), Contentoo (SaaS, Laravel/NestJS/Kafka), Reyo (40+ API integrations), reibert.info (high-load). Stack: Laravel/NestJS + Next.js + PostgreSQL + Docker. API-first — mobile connects without rewriting the backend. Payment: €25/hour, by stages — completed → checked → paid. Stage 1 (~12 hours, €300, 2 days) — expertise and solutions: MVP architecture, database schema, OpenAPI parking-flow, stage plan, recommendations on stack and integrations. Stage 2 (~80 hours, €2,000, 2 weeks): auth, 1 car, parking — map, start/stop, timer, history. Stage 3 (~60 hours, €1,500, 1.5 weeks): Stripe or Montonio, admin (zones/sessions/users). Stage 4 (~40 hours, €1,000, 1 week): testing, prod-deploy, API documentation. Total MVP: ~192 hours, €4,800, ~5 weeks (24 working days of 8 hours). Support: €500–750/month (~20–30 hours). Questions: is there a Figma/brand book? API of parking operators in Estonia or v1 — own zones?

Alexey, greetings. You have an excellent vision for the automotive ecosystem, but let's take off the rose-colored glasses and analyze this stack and the MVP scope from the perspective of harsh engineering architecture and your budget.

If you try to launch all 6 domains (parking, service stations, tires, rentals, CRM, warehouse) in the first release using the React/Next.js + NestJS stack, you will burn through all 5k euros just on infrastructure, SSR configuration, and initial database design, without reaching a working product.

As a lead architect, I state: the stack you proposed for the MVP in the current realities is a financial and technical trap:
1. Server-Side Rendering (Next.js) for closed client dashboards, parking maps, and CRM is severe overengineering. There is nothing to index for search bots; everything is hidden behind authorization. Next.js will artificially double the cost and timeline of frontend development.
2. NestJS is good, but the speed of MVP development on it lags behind monoliths.

Hello, Alexey!
The platform does not allow for a detailed response—there is a limit on the number of characters. So I will be brief.

Parking is your key feature; I am building the MVP around it, while laying out other verticals in the architecture as separate modules. The same approach addresses your requirement for "mobile without rewriting the backend."

1. Architecture. NestJS, modular monolith (microservices at the start are unnecessary complexity). REST + OpenAPI—a ready contract makes mobile applications inexpensive. Next.js, for parking at the start PWA (faster to market). PostgreSQL + PostGIS (geo-zones), BullMQ for time logic and notifications (expiration, auto-renewal). Auth—JWT with a foundation for Smart-ID/Mobile-ID. Payment Montonio + Stripe through a single layer. Infrastructure—Hetzner.

2. Timelines. Discovery 1–1.5 weeks → Technical specifications and exact price. MVP (dashboard + car + parking in-depth + payments + basic admin panel) ≈ 3–3.5 months. Service/buses/rent—added in separate phases without rewriting the core.

3. Cost. Discovery—a fixed €600; I will determine the exact development price based on its results. The estimate for the MVP is €8,000—€13,000. I consciously do not mention an exact figure until Discovery: an unclear scope will lead to incorrect pricing. Later—it will be painful for both of us.

Hello, Alexey.
I carefully looked at the description. In my opinion, it is important not just to gather many sections, but not to lose the main working scenario: a person added a car, started parking, paid, received a notification, and the administrator sees the client, the car, the parking session, the payment, and the history.
I would not start with trying to implement the entire ecosystem right away. For the first MVP, it makes more sense to gather the core: client cabinet, cars, documents, basic CRM, map of parking zones, starting and ending parking, history, payments, and notifications. If this outline is done correctly, then later it can be calmly expanded to include car service, tires, rental, and insurance.
For the stack, I would suggest Next.js / React on the frontend, NestJS / Node.js on the backend, PostgreSQL with PostGIS for geodata, Redis for parking sessions, timers, and notifications. The backend should be made as a normal API right away, so that later iOS and Android can be connected without rewriting the system.
From recent experience: I participated in the development of a taxi-like platform, where I worked on the admin/backend module with users, orders, statuses, and synchronization with the main system. I also have experience with CRM/ERP systems, marketplace/payment logic, roles, statuses, admin panels, payments, and operational processes.
I would consider the rate of 5000 EUR as the first working stage, not as the entire platform with insurance, rental, tire shop, and integrations of all operators. The full scope is better fixed after clarifying the boundaries of the MVP and dependencies on integrations.
The main question for evaluation: in the first release, should parking operate on your own logic of tariffs and zones, or is integration with parking operators in Estonia needed right away?
